About Grandover Resort & Spa
Grandover Resort & Spa is a AAA Four-Diamond property located in Greensboro, North Carolina. The 1,500-acre property features two 18-hole championship courses, the East and West and a driving range with instruction. The hotel has 244 guest rooms and suites, plus a full-service spa, fitness center, year-round indoor pool within the spa and a large, outdoor pool. Conditions
Played the East course. Two things need to improve before I would be willing to return:
1) they need to reopen the par 3 - 12th hole. Currently Closed for rebuilding. Ruins the layout and compromises the 13th hole too.
2) the greens were in poor shape. Several were very spotty and all of them were very slow. They are not mowing them down yet which makes for very bumpy, very slow conditions. Not what I’m used to on this course and certainly lowers the value.
